匿名内部类了解一二

1.    匿名内部类首先是一个类的内部定义的,是用来帮助这个外部类去更好的实现一些功能,主要用在想方法传递一个对象做为参数。

public void fun(new Persion{System.out.printIn("Hi")});

 向方法传了一个person的对象。Person是外部类,匿名类只是一个类体,这个类体创建的对象上转型为Person的对象了。

2.    1

猜你喜欢

转载自www.cnblogs.com/baxianhua/p/9773520.html